  • How to stay motivated during the final weeks of dissertation writing?

    Posted by Chris Lewis on April 24, 2025 at 2:13 am

    The last few weeks before submitting your dissertation can be both exciting and stressful. You’re close to the finish line, but polishing chapters, editing footnotes, and refining arguments can feel never-ending. Burnout is common at this stage, so it’s important to pace yourself and take short mental breaks.

    One effective strategy is setting micro-goals—like reviewing one section per day or finalizing references over a weekend. If you’re stuck, even talking things through with a peer or using a writing checklist can help you see progress.
